I have always, and will always feel that Swoop operation belongs under Repulsorlift Operation. Every argument I read to the contrary strengthens my resolve because a precedent was already established with this skill. So, let me elaborate:
• Yes a swoop and a Landspeeder use different driving techniques, just as a car and a motorcycle. Using the car motorcycle analogy though, a speederbike handles and is driven differently than a landspeeder or a skiff as well, and would be driven more like a Swoop (as it is a relative of the swoop). Speederbike operation is under Repulsorlift Operation, and therefore, so shood Swoop Operation be.
• Yes, a swoop isn't just repulsorlift, it has Ion engines. So, too, do many airspeeders, and a few racing landspeeders. Airspeeders and racing landspeeders fall under Repulsorlift Operation, and so too should Swoop riding.
• Swoops are capable of extreme altitudes, some can even reach the upper stratosphere. Airspeeders too, can reach extreme altitudes based on their manufacture. Airspeeders fall under Repulsorlift Operation, so should Swoop riding.
The only argument made that gives any credence to a seperate skill is:
• The extreme speed and g-forces of a swoop can sometimes be too great for a human. Some swoops are supersonic. Special suites would be needed.
I feel this is insufficient to warrent a seperate skill altogether. Perhaps some stamina, dex, and strength rolls as speed increases... IMHO.
